Fan Built Bots are characters created by Hasbro by polling fandom. Thus far two sets of polls have been held, resulting in the creation of a single bot, Windblade, in 2013 and a combiner, Victorion, in 2015.

2013 polls

For the first Fan Built Bot, polls were conducted on transformers.com over the course of a week each. The first round was held between April 18th and May 5th, and included the following questions:[1]

The second round was held between May 10th and May 17th, and included four more questions:[2]

The result, Windblade, was revealed first in art form at San Diego Comic-Con 2013, with her toy subsequently revealed at Toy Fair 2014. Windblade obtained a toy in the 10th wave of Deluxe-class Generations toys; she also starred in a 4-issue miniseries from IDW Publishing, which was later revived as an ongoing series.

Due to the character's popularity, a different incarnation of Windblade is also featured in the Transformers: Robots in Disguise cartoon, with an episode focused on her.

2015 polls

The second set of poll was announced on January 15, 2015, this time to create a whole new combiner. The polling was done via the Transformers mobile app. The first set of polls began on January 25. Each limb was voted on individually.

Round 2 began on February 11 and including picking more specific modes for the limbs, two of which had been selected as aerial vehicles, and two as cars.

A round also took place via the Toys"R"Us Twitter between February 17 and 28 to select which power the combiner would have.

Victorion, the resulting female combiner, was featured in IDW Publishing's Combiner Hunters comic as well as getting a toy.
